Win 10 + Clarion 10 = Problem

Clarion, Clarion 7

Модератор: Дед Пахом

Правила форума
При написании вопроса или обсуждении проблемы, не забывайте указывать версию Clarion который Вы используете.
А так же пользуйтесь спец. тегами при вставке исходников!!!
Аватара пользователя
RaFaeL
✯ Ветеран ✯
Сообщения: 1376
Зарегистрирован: 24 Март 2009, 17:59
Откуда: НН
Благодарил (а): 7 раз
Поблагодарили: 1 раз
Контактная информация:

Win 10 + Clarion 10 = Problem

Сообщение RaFaeL »

Игорь Столяров писал(а): В подтверждение к написанному ранее: программы собранные в C63 также виснут под "Юбилейной" Win10 при нажатии одиночного ALT ...
У меня не виснет, специально проверил. С63 последний, Win10 юбилейная со всеми обновлениями (последний раз вчера обновилась)
Аватара пользователя
Игорь Столяров
Ветеран движения
Сообщения: 7322
Зарегистрирован: 07 Июль 2005, 10:19
Откуда: г. Ростов-на-ДоМу
Благодарил (а): 13 раз
Поблагодарили: 48 раз

Win 10 + Clarion 10 = Problem

Сообщение Игорь Столяров »

RaFaeL писал(а): У меня не виснет, специально проверил
Тут вопрос в том где проверять ... Проблем проявляется в приложении с FRAME и MDI окнами.
Открываем в меню любое MDI окно, нажимаем и отпускаем клавишу ALT. Висим.
В приложениях с SDI окнами - все работает штатно.
За теми кто отстал - не возвращаться. (С) Кодекс
Аватара пользователя
RaFaeL
✯ Ветеран ✯
Сообщения: 1376
Зарегистрирован: 24 Март 2009, 17:59
Откуда: НН
Благодарил (а): 7 раз
Поблагодарили: 1 раз
Контактная информация:

Win 10 + Clarion 10 = Problem

Сообщение RaFaeL »

Именно такое приложение
http://www.monitor-crm.ru/zip/setup40d.exe попробуй проверь, результаты сообщи. Может тут от конкретной винды зависит или вообще от какого-то приложения типа переключателя раскладки. Правда у нас менюшка вроде не совсем штатная. Видимо, зависон должен случиться в момент перехода фокуса в меню, но у нас просто никак не реагирует на Alt
Аватара пользователя
Игорь Столяров
Ветеран движения
Сообщения: 7322
Зарегистрирован: 07 Июль 2005, 10:19
Откуда: г. Ростов-на-ДоМу
Благодарил (а): 13 раз
Поблагодарили: 48 раз

Win 10 + Clarion 10 = Problem

Сообщение Игорь Столяров »

Со всем согласный я.
Программа - не зависает, но в ней какое-то нештатное меню и отсутствует реакция на ALT для перехода
в меню FRAME вообще .... Знать бы как - я бы тоже с удовольствием вырубил реакцию на ALT из окон - и все.

А для проверки наличия проблемы - попробуй собрать, что-нибудь из вечного - например пример INVENTORY.
За теми кто отстал - не возвращаться. (С) Кодекс
kreator
✯ Ветеран ✯
Сообщения: 4960
Зарегистрирован: 28 Май 2009, 15:54
Откуда: Москва
Благодарил (а): 6 раз
Поблагодарили: 19 раз

Win 10 + Clarion 10 = Problem

Сообщение kreator »

Переключатель раскладки тут совсем не причём, Alt+Shift, к примеру, работает как надо. Проблема именно в одиночном Alt (ситуация несколько другая, чем в 2006г., немногие переходят в меню фрейма по Alt). Отрубать совсем Alt я считаю неправильным, стандартный Виндоусовый механизм, работает во всех программах. Во всяком случает до тех пор, пока совсем не перейдём на управление пальцами (жестами :mrgreen: ), не будем пользоваться клавиатурой. А сколько SV нужно времени, чтобы среагировать? В прошлый раз, кажется, долго проблему решали, раз чужие заплатки появились.
We are hard at work… for you. :)
Аватара пользователя
Игорь Столяров
Ветеран движения
Сообщения: 7322
Зарегистрирован: 07 Июль 2005, 10:19
Откуда: г. Ростов-на-ДоМу
Благодарил (а): 13 раз
Поблагодарили: 48 раз

Win 10 + Clarion 10 = Problem

Сообщение Игорь Столяров »

kreator писал(а): немногие переходят в меню фрейма по Alt
В этом-то и проблема диагностики данного глюка. Я, например, узнал об этом от клиента, у которого западает
клавиша Shift при переключении раскладки клавиатуры.
Клавиши SHIFT часто "убивают" - т.к. это управление направлением во многих играх. :)

Поэтому в принципе, отключение перехода в меню по ALT - позволило бы решить вопрос, на то время по SV
устранит проблему. Судя по примеру программы Monitor-CRM - это возможно, осталось разобраться как ... ;)
За теми кто отстал - не возвращаться. (С) Кодекс
Аватара пользователя
Игорь Столяров
Ветеран движения
Сообщения: 7322
Зарегистрирован: 07 Июль 2005, 10:19
Откуда: г. Ростов-на-ДоМу
Благодарил (а): 13 раз
Поблагодарили: 48 раз

Win 10 + Clarion 10 = Problem

Сообщение Игорь Столяров »

Кто-нибудь юзает последний доступный C10.12349 ?
"Альта-висение" собранных приложений под Win10 "Юбилейная" наблюдается ?
За теми кто отстал - не возвращаться. (С) Кодекс
kreator
✯ Ветеран ✯
Сообщения: 4960
Зарегистрирован: 28 Май 2009, 15:54
Откуда: Москва
Благодарил (а): 6 раз
Поблагодарили: 19 раз

Win 10 + Clarion 10 = Problem

Сообщение kreator »

Ну я же и написал про это. Посмотри мой пост. Правда, я уже не помню, что раньше накатил - Винду или Кларион.
We are hard at work… for you. :)
Аватара пользователя
Игорь Столяров
Ветеран движения
Сообщения: 7322
Зарегистрирован: 07 Июль 2005, 10:19
Откуда: г. Ростов-на-ДоМу
Благодарил (а): 13 раз
Поблагодарили: 48 раз

Win 10 + Clarion 10 = Problem

Сообщение Игорь Столяров »

Спасибо - нашел поиском по номеру релиза C10. :)
Юзеры жалуются, Microsoft свою юбилейную заразу неотвратимо насаждает по миру ... :(
За теми кто отстал - не возвращаться. (С) Кодекс
kreator
✯ Ветеран ✯
Сообщения: 4960
Зарегистрирован: 28 Май 2009, 15:54
Откуда: Москва
Благодарил (а): 6 раз
Поблагодарили: 19 раз

Win 10 + Clarion 10 = Problem

Сообщение kreator »

Может поднять старый шаблон, который решал раньше эту проблему? У меня есть от Carl Barnes.
We are hard at work… for you. :)
Аватара пользователя
Игорь Столяров
Ветеран движения
Сообщения: 7322
Зарегистрирован: 07 Июль 2005, 10:19
Откуда: г. Ростов-на-ДоМу
Благодарил (а): 13 раз
Поблагодарили: 48 раз

Win 10 + Clarion 10 = Problem

Сообщение Игорь Столяров »

Сбрось - давай посмотрим.
В принципе, что нужно делать и хромому понятно:
1. Субкласим AppFrame (т.к. в приложения Clarion эти события не проходят);
2. Перехватываем системное событие MDISETMENU (?!) и гасим его. Все.

Просто не обучены мы в регионах такому пилотажу. :(
За теми кто отстал - не возвращаться. (С) Кодекс
kreator
✯ Ветеран ✯
Сообщения: 4960
Зарегистрирован: 28 Май 2009, 15:54
Откуда: Москва
Благодарил (а): 6 раз
Поблагодарили: 19 раз

Win 10 + Clarion 10 = Problem

Сообщение kreator »

Игорь Столяров писал(а):Просто не обучены мы в регионах такому пилотажу.
Да на фига, если уже есть. Проверил - работает. Программа не виснет. Вход в меню по "Alt+Ф" (ну у меня первый пункт "Файл"), вроде можно изменить.
CBAltWin7Fix.TPL
(5.64 КБ) 347 скачиваний
We are hard at work… for you. :)
Аватара пользователя
Игорь Столяров
Ветеран движения
Сообщения: 7322
Зарегистрирован: 07 Июль 2005, 10:19
Откуда: г. Ростов-на-ДоМу
Благодарил (а): 13 раз
Поблагодарили: 48 раз

Win 10 + Clarion 10 = Problem

Сообщение Игорь Столяров »

Ура !!! Заработало ! :) Спасибо !
С этим и перезимуем, а там уже и SV подтянется ... ;)
За теми кто отстал - не возвращаться. (С) Кодекс
kreator
✯ Ветеран ✯
Сообщения: 4960
Зарегистрирован: 28 Май 2009, 15:54
Откуда: Москва
Благодарил (а): 6 раз
Поблагодарили: 19 раз

Win 10 + Clarion 10 = Problem

Сообщение kreator »

Игорь Столяров писал(а):С этим и перезимуем, а там уже и SV подтянется ... ;)
Перезимовали!!! Выкатили ещё шаблон, который решает эту проблему.
UltimateWindowExample.Tpl
(1.6 КБ) 327 скачиваний
We are hard at work… for you. :)
gopstop2007
✯ Ветеран ✯
Сообщения: 1702
Зарегистрирован: 25 Март 2009, 21:55
Благодарил (а): 9 раз
Поблагодарили: 4 раза

Win 10 + Clarion 10 = Problem

Сообщение gopstop2007 »

Кинули бы на все :)https://github.com/ClarionLive/UltimateSQL
“Есть всего 2 типа языков: те, на которые все жалуются и те, которыми никто не пользуется.” — Бьерн Страуструп
Ответить